CapeTownMagazine & Cape Town Face to Face with Tsotsi Cast
The cast of South Africa's Oscar winning film Tsotsi were welcomed as true superstars during their visit to Cape Town.
The cast of South Africa's Oscar winning film Tsotsi paid a visit to Cape Town yesterday, to speak about the movie, their current success and their future.

The cast of Tsotsi - including lead actor and actress
Presley Cheneyagae and Terry Pheto - were welcomed as real super stars at the premiers office on Whale Street in Cape Town. A large group of fans had gathered outside the office, armed with Tsotsi posters and cameras.

After giving the Tsotsi stars a warm welcome,
Premier of the Western Cape province Ebrahim Rasool said it was an honor to have the cast of South Africa favourite movie at his office: "Tsotsi is a real South African story: in the Western Cape alone 20 000 youngsters are part of a gang."

"Tsotsi is also about hope and redemption, and thus gives a positive message to the young generation," Rasool continued. "Therefore Tsotsi can do what all of our police, workers and jails can do: being an example and showing these kids that there is a way out. We need to understand why these youngsters have become who they are. Tsotsi gives us an explanation."

After handing over a signed Tsotsi Poster
- with the credit "Academy Award Winner" - Terry Pheto and Presley Cheneyagae spoke briefly about the reaction on the Oscar, the way the movie changed their lives and about future film projects. "There are offers," said Terry. "But we will see!"

Source: Cape Town Magazine.com / Miriam Mannak / March 15 2005
